Acceleware has been granted a patent for systems and methods that control electromagnetic heating of a hydrocarbon medium using a signal generator and load with frequency and time-dependent impedance. The technology determines desired heating cycles, operational states, and signal generator settings to efficiently heat the medium. Control system for electromagnetic heating of hydrocarbon medium

Source: United States Patent and Trademark Office (USPTO). Credit: Acceleware Ltd

A recently granted patent (Publication Number: US11946351B2) discloses a system for controlling electromagnetic heating of a hydrocarbon medium using a signal generator and a load with frequency, time, and amplitude-dependent impedance. The system includes a processor that determines a desired heating life cycle for the hydrocarbon medium, the current operational state, and a desired operational state to maximize alignment with the desired heating life cycle. The processor also calculates signal generator control settings to achieve the desired operational state, which are then applied to the signal generator to generate an output signal that heats the hydrocarbon medium by exciting the load.

Furthermore, the system's processor can update the desired heating life cycle based on the difference between the current operational state and the desired heating life cycle. The load, which includes radiating structures in the hydrocarbon medium, couples electromagnetic energy into the medium when excited by the output signal. The system also involves determining model parameters, such as temperature, pressure, and impedance, using sensors to measure actual properties and adjusting expected statuses accordingly. Additionally, the processor can determine desired load control settings and solvent control settings based on the desired operational state, providing a comprehensive approach to controlling electromagnetic heating in hydrocarbon mediums.
